How to Join PRSA

PRSA is the Public Relations Society of America organization and supports those who work in or teach public relations. This organization was chartered in 1947 to advance the public relations profession, set standards and provide professional development through multiple means on both the national and local levels. To join this organization, take a look at these simple steps.

Instructions

Difficulty: Easy
Step1
Visit the official PRSA website and locate the membership area of the site. There are many smaller sites, such as those for particular chapters, which can be of benefit in making the decision to join the organization. Membership is encouraged to enhance your professional career, gain access to educational opportunities, network and more.
Step2
Determine if you fit the criteria for membership. Any person that devotes at least 50% of their professional job practicing public relations or teaching the curriculum in an accredited institution is eligible to join. The site also explains rules for those who are unemployed and their options for retaining membership.
Step3
Identify the type of membership you prefer. Members pay a certain fee per year and have access to all membership benefits. Associate members fall into one of four categories based on experience, association with the Public Relations Student Society of America (PRSSA) and more. Group membership is also available, based on the number of participants from one organization.
Step4
Join online, by mail or by fax by providing your registration forms to the society's administrative offices. If you plan to join online, you need to sign up for an account before you complete the application.
Step5
Make your membership payment, including initiation fees, and receive confirmation of payment. Then enjoy your new membership and take full advantage of all of the opportunities that are available.
